The present city of Karachi was reputedly founded as "Kolachi" by Baloch tribes from Makran, Balochistan, who established a small fishing community in the area. The original name "Kolachi" survives in the name of a well-known Karachi locality named Mai Kolachi.
Lahore is the capital of Pakistan's largest province, Punjab; with a population exceeding 10 million, it is a megacity and ranked as the country's second largest metropolis (after Karachi). Collectively, it is also the fifth largest city in South Asia and the 26th largest city in the world in terms of population.
According to oral traditions, Lahore was named after Lava, son of the Hindu god Rama, who supposedly founded the city.

The origin of Lahore can be traced back somewhere between 1st and 7th centuries A.D. It is, however, inferred by historians that Lahore was actually founded by Loh e son of Rama, characterized as the Hindu god in Ramayana. According to Sir Robert Montgomery, Lahore rose to importance between 2nd and 4th centuries.

In Lahore, the summers are short, sweltering, humid, and clear and the winters are short, cool, dry, and mostly clear. Over the course of the year, the temperature typically varies from 46°F to 103°F and is rarely below 41°F or above 110°F.

Lahore was then annexed to the British Empire, and made capital of British Punjab. Lahore was central to the independence movements of both India and Pakistan, with the city being the site of both the declaration of Indian Independence, and the resolution calling for the establishment of Pakistan.
